The solicitation for LED HEADLIGHT BAND under number SPMYM226Q7790 is a total small business set-aside issued by the Department of Defense through DLA Maritime - Puget Sound, with performance centered in Bremerton, Washington. Bidders must submit quotes electronically via the SAM.gov website and ensure full compliance with all solicitation requirements, including accurate completion of specific sections such as contractor information, point of contact details, quote submission, and manufacturer data in K21. All proposals must be FOB destination Bremerton, WA, and include lead time or delivery date information. Non-commercial items require a current NIST SP 800-171 assessment not older than three years, while commercial off-the-shelf items are exempt provided they are clearly identified during submission. Bidders must also complete and check applicable FAR clauses in Sections K, sign all required boxes on Page 1 including boxes 30a, b, and c, and submit the fully completed and signed solicitation via email to emilie.madden@dla.com by the deadline of Thursday, 23 July 2026, at 12:00 PM. Failure to submit a signed and properly completed solicitation will render the bid non-responsive.

        THIS SOLICITATION AND ANY SUBSEQUENT AMENDMENTS WILL BE POSTED TO THE SAM WEBSITE: SAM.GOV
        ELECTRONIC SUBMISSION OF QUOTES IS AVAILABLE THROUGH THE SAM WEBSITE.
        To be considered for award, if the contractor (awardee) is required to implement NIST SP 800-171, the contractor (awardee) shall have a current assessment as detailed in DFARS 252.204-7019 (I.E., not more than 3 years old unless a lesser time is specified in the solicitation)
        
        **Items deemed to be Commercial Off The Shelf (COTS) are exempt from NIST SP 800-171 requirement.  Must identify and provide information to contracting officer on bid during solicitation period**
        
          Please read the contract in its entirety.
        
          If you are able to provide a quote be sure to provide the following information in the sections provided below:
        
            1. Page 1 BLK 17a. Provide Contractor's info and cage code.
            2. Section A. A1 – 1. Enter The Contractor's POC
            3. Section B. – Enter your Quote and any other info we should know.
            4. Please quote FOB Destination BREMERTON, WA.
            5. Section B. K21 – Check the appropriate box and provide the Manufacturer’s Name, Address and the Country of Manufacturing
            6. Section F. –  Provide the Lead Time and/or Delivery Date.
            7. Section K. - 52.204-24 (d)(1) and (2) Check the applicable boxes
            8. Section K.- 52.212-3(b)-(p) Check the applicable boxes
            9. Page 1 -  Read box 28 and sign boxes 30 a, b, and c.
            10. Return the signed and filled out solicitation with your quote by THURSDAY, 23 JULY 2026 12PM 
             
        FOR YOUR BID TO BE DEEMED RESPONSIVE A SIGNED AND COMPLETED SOLICITATION MUST BE SUBMITTED VIA EMAIL.
        
        EMAIL:  emilie.madden@dla.com

FOSSIL WATCHESThe solicitation SPMYM226Q7241, issued by DLA Maritime - Puget Sound, seeks to procure 100 women’s and 200 men’s Fossil watches, identified by their respective part numbers and engraved with MILSTRIP codes, under a Small Disadvantaged Veteran-Owned Small Business (SDVOSB) sole source set-aside. All bids must be submitted via email to Tricia Wintersteen at TRICIA.WINTERSTEEN@DLA.MIL by the deadline of May 18, 2026, at 5:00 PM, and must include a completed and signed solicitation, manufacturer details, country of origin, and delivery lead time quoted FOB destination. The contract is structured as a commercial item acquisition under FAR Part 12, with a Lowest Price Technically Acceptable (LPTA) award methodology, where technical acceptability is a pass/fail determination and price is the primary selection criterion, though past performance—assessed via PPIRS-SR ratings—may disqualify offers with red or yellow quality ratings or delivery scores below 70. Offerors must confirm whether items are Commercial Off-The-Shelf (COTS), as COTS products are exempt from NIST SP 800-171 cybersecurity requirements; non-COTS items require a current cybersecurity assessment no more than three years old to satisfy DFARS 252.204-7019. Packaging and marking must conform to ASTM-D-3951, with prohibited materials including asbestos, excelsior, loose polystyrene, and newspaper, while wood packaging must be heat-treated to 56°C for 30 minutes and ALSC-certified. Each item must be marked with the NSN or part number, noun nomenclature, quantity, contract number, origin, and destination, and must comply with MIL-STD-130 for machine-readable unique item identification (UII) and MIL-STD-129 for shipment labeling, though barcoding is not mandatory unless specified. Items will be delivered to Puget Sound Naval Shipyard IMF in Bremerton, WA, under FOB Destination terms, with inspection and acceptance performed by the Government at that location; any nonconformance may result in rejection of the entire lot.
